Study Notes

Kings and Cities

  • Adoni-zedek was the King of Jerusalem during the events of Joshua Chapter 10.
  • Gibeon, a strongly fortified city, struck fear in Adoni-zedek, known for its warrior men.

Alliances and Warfare

  • Adoni-zedek sought help from several allies: Hoham (king of Jarmuth), Piram (king of Eglon), Japhia (king of Lachish), and Debir (king of Hebron).
  • Five Amorite kings joined forces against Gibeon.

Call for Help and Response

  • The men of Gibeon reached out to Joshua for assistance upon being attacked.
  • Joshua mobilized from Gilgal, leading his warriors to help Gibeon.

Divine Assurance and Strategy

  • The Lord assured Joshua not to fear the Amorite kings, declaring their defeat imminent.
  • Joshua and the Israelites marched all night to confront the enemy.

Battlefield Events

  • Joshua launched a surprise attack, causing panic among the Amorites.
  • The Israelites pursued the fleeing kings as far as Azekah and Makkedah.

Divine Intervention

  • God aided the Israelites by sending large hailstones that caused more casualties than they inflicted.
  • Joshua commanded the sun to stand still at Gibeon and the moon in the Valley of Aijalon, allowing them to continue the battle.

Unusual Day

  • The sun remained halted for about a whole day, a record-setting event detailed in the Book of Jashar.
  • This day was notable because the Lord listened to Joshua’s request.

Aftermath of Battle

  • After the victory, Joshua returned with Israel to Gilgal.
  • The five defeated kings hid in a cave at Makkedah, where Joshua ordered them contained and guarded.

Execution of Captives

  • Joshua commanded the chiefs of Israel to place their feet on the necks of the captured kings.
  • The captured kings were killed, hanged on trees until evening, and later buried in the cave.

Destruction and Conquest

  • Joshua destroyed the city of Makkedah on the same day the Amorite kings were executed.
  • The Lord also granted Israel victory over Lachish and Libnah.

Territorial Gains

  • Joshua captured all the territory up to Goshen and Gibeon.
  • The chapter concludes with Joshua and the Israelites returning to their camp at Gilgal.
